Job Description

Innovation starts from the heart. At Edwards Lifesciences, we’re dedicated to developing ground-breaking technologies with a genuine impact on patients’ lives. At the core of this commitment is our investment in cutting-edge information technology. This supports our innovation and collaboration on a global scale, enabling our diverse teams to optimize both efficiency and success. As part of our IT team, your expertise and commitment will help facilitate our patient-focused mission by developing and enhancing technological solutions.The Senior Architect, CLM Applications is responsible for defining, governing, and evolving the enterprise architecture for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) solutions across the organization. This role partners closely with Legal, Compliance, Procurement, Sales, and IT stakeholders to establish a scalable, secure, and globally harmonized CLM platform that aligns with enterprise architecture standards and business objectives. As our team builds and configures our CLM platform on Malbek, we're seeking an architect with hands-on Malbek experience to help lead this work. The Senior Architect provides strategic and technical leadership for CLM implementations, integrations, data architecture, solution governance, and continuous improvement initiatives.How you'll make an impact: Establish best practices for the implementation, evolution, maintenance, and support of complex enterprise solutions. Ensure scalable architecture and seamless integration across platforms and functions throughout the planning, design, execution, and operational stages.Define system platform and project scope and remain actively engaged through implementation.Provide design and architecture guidance to project teams executing tactical projects and initiatives.Translate business requirements into specific solutions, applications, or process designs in collaboration with project teams.Serve as a subject matter expert in at least one area, such as system platform design, business process, software and hardware architecture, project management, or industry practices.Identify and evaluate integration opportunities for lower tier systems. Provide input on new integration opportunities, including tool selection and shared data and code resources.Establish communication and documentation approaches that highlight external emerging developments and promote new technologies, standards, and methodologies.Document clear and concise change management for systems and processes by following IT and Quality change procedures.Provide training, coaching, and knowledge transfer to team members.Perform other incidental duties as assigned.What you'll need (Required):Bachelor’s degree in information technology,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field, with 10 years of related experience.Related professional certifications in areas such as programming, database development, project management, or similar disciplines.Architecture certification, such as TOGAF, Zachman, or a similar architecture framework.Experience working in a highly regulated environment, such as medical device, pharmaceutical, or a similar industry.What else we look for (preferred): Working hands-on experience with Malbek CLM, including exposure to configuration and/or implementation.Excellent facilitation and presentation skills.Strong problem-solving, organizational, analytical, and critical thinking skills.Excellent documentation, communication, and interpersonal skills, including negotiation, relationship management, and the ability to drive objectives forward.Recognized expertise within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) platform(s)Expert knowledge in at least one discipline, such as Contract Lifecycle Management or Configuration Management.Strong technical knowledge of technical languages or data management systems, middleware and direct API connectorsAbility to interact professionally with all organizational levels and proactively escalate issues to the appropriate levels of management.Ability to man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ment.Strict attention to detail.Adhere to all company rules and requirements (e.g., pandemic protocols, Environmental Health & Safety rules) and take adequate control measures in preventing injuries to themselves and others as well as to the protection of environment and prevention of pollution under their span of influence/controlAligning our overall business objectives with performance, we offer competitive salaries, performance-based incentives, and a wide variety of benefits programs to address the diverse individual needs of our employees and their families.For California, the base pay range for this position is $139,000 to $196,000 (highly experienced).The pay for the successful candidate will depend on various factors (e.g., qualifications, education, prior experience). Applications will be accepted while this position is posted on our Careers website. Edwards is an Equal Opportunity/Affirmative Action employer including protected Veterans and individuals with disabilities.
